We present a young female patient with three caval drainages after complete Fontan's
procedure and with bilateral bidirectional cavopulmonary connections who underwent
orthotopic heart transplantation. Instead of reconstructing the hypoplastic innominate
vein the persistent left superior caval vein was reanastomosed via the recipient's
coronary sinus into the right atrium.
